Dow Building Solutions has won the “Partners of Choice” Award.

For the sixth consecutive year, Dow Building Solutions has won the renowned “Partners of Choice” Award from David Weekley Homes, the nation’s second-largest for profit, privately held home builder. Dow stands out among the 150 evaluated companies as one of only two suppliers to achieve A’s in both quality and service (the highest possible rating) each year since the program’s inception.

“Remarkable falls short of describing Dow’s accomplishment,” said Bill Justus, vice president for David Weekley Homes, and the chief catalyst behind the homebuilder’s leading-edge supplier evaluation system. “The economy and its corresponding challenges have changed dramatically over the last six years. Nevertheless, during this time Dow has demonstrated world-class leadership and performance as reported by approximately 5,400 David Weekley Homes’ team members. Our raters have spoken, and through this period, nobody has higher quality or provides better service than Dow.”

Award winners are chosen based on the annual “National Trading Partner Survey,” given to approximately 600 team members whose roles range from accounts payable to upper management.
